I am working on configuring an automated install for use in the office and have come up with a preseed file that, for the most part, works. The sticking point I've hit is getting the "ubuntu-desktop" to install. When I added the following line to my preseed file:


tasksel tasksel/first multiselect ubuntu-desktop, print-server, openssh-server

I get the following error:


The following packages have unmet dependencies:
xserver-xorg-video-all : Depends: xserver-xorg-video-ati but it is not installable
Depends: xserver-xorg-video-nouveau but it is not installable
E: unabele to correct problems, you have held broken packages.
tasksel: apatitude failed (100)

Removing the tasksel line from the configuration resolves this error but it does not fix my problem because I need the tasksel portion to be automated with no user input and removing this line causes it to prompt the installer for a response.

Any help on this would be appreciated, for completeness I've placed my preseed file (redacted of company info) in a github gist:
